    "editor1": "The Poona Club Open: Chandigarh\u2019s Karandeep Kochhar and Kshitij Naveed Kaul of Delhi continued as co-leaders for the second day in succession in the INR 1 crore prize-fund The Poona Club Open golf tournament being played at the Poona Club Golf Course here on Thursday. Kochhar (64-66) and Kaul (64-66), the round one joint leaders by one shot, continued in the lead at the halfway stage with totals of 12-under 130 after they carded scores of five-under 66 in round two.<p>The PGTI Ranking leader Veer Ahlawat and Samarth Dwivedi too returned rounds of 66 to be tied third at eight-under 134. The cut came down at even-par 142. Fifty-eight professionals made the cut.<\/p>\r\n\r\n<p>Karandeep Kochhar, a 10th tee starter, couldn\u2019t have asked for a better start to the day as he holed his chip from 35 yards for an eagle on the Par-4 10th. A couple of good iron shots and two long conversions then earned him birdies on the 13th and 16th. The bogeys on the 18th and the second holes did not derail his round as Karandeep rallied with a great recovery shot over the trees to claim an eagle on the seventh. Kochhar followed that up with a 15-feet birdie conversion on the eighth.<\/p>\r\n\r\n<p>Karandeep said, \u201cConsistency was the key for me today. I stuck to my game plan of hitting the driver everywhere. I had a great start with the eagle that got the momentum going for me. The highlight of the round was the approach shot on the seventh that led to an eagle. I played to my game plan by being aggressive there. Kudos to my caddie who guided me well on that shot.<\/p>\r\n\r\n<p>\u201cAs this is my seventh tournament in as many weeks, my back is hurting a bit. So, it\u2019s important for me to get some physiotherapy and focus on rest and recovery,\u201d he said.<\/p>\r\n\r\n<p>Kshitij Naveed Kaul drove the Par-4 14th green for the second consecutive day to pick up a birdie there. He added another birdie thereafter but stumbled with a couple of bogeys on the 17th and third. Kaul\u2019s purple patch began with his outstanding bunker shot on the fifth that led to a tap-in birdie.<\/p>\r\n\r\n<p>Kshitij, who won his maiden professional title at the Poona Club Golf Course back in 2019 and has also won amateur, junior and sub-junior events at the same venue, went on to bag an eagle with a 12-feet conversion on the Par-5 seventh. He signed off with a flourish by following up the eagle with birdies from short range on the eighth and ninth.<\/p>\r\n\r\n<p>Kshitij said, \u201cI just feel I\u2019m beginning to find my rhythm now after a couple of decent finishes in the last two events. I\u2019ve been striking it really well and closing the day with eagle-birdie-birdie was quite a confidence-booster.
